On 09/04/2014 10:23 AM, John Macdonald wrote:
Hi,I wanted to get general comment/concensus about a top level name that I am proposing. I'm starting to organize a set of modules for managing jobs on a computer cluster. I intend it to work much like DBI - with a top level abstract interface that programs can use, actually implemented by drivers that translate the common interface into the interface used by the particular type of compute cluster that is being accessed. Initially, I will provide a driver for SGE, since that is what we have and use in our lab (but after I have that running, my PI can get me access to a couple of other type of compute cluster to add some more. For naming, I am planning to use: ComputeCluster - top level name - will provide switching functions to create a class of object for a particular cluster type
Could that be shortened to simply: Cluster ?
